Hi, I'm MD Samiul Islam

I'm a final-year B.Tech Computer Science and Engineering student at Adamas University, a freelance software engineer, and a product builder from India. My primary focus is backend engineering, system architecture, databases, infrastructure, and AI-powered systems.

I like building things end-to-end. That means going beyond writing application code and thinking about APIs, data models, system architecture, deployment, networking, performance, reliability, and how software actually operates in production.

As a freelancer and solopreneur, I've worked on real products and business problems rather than limiting myself to academic projects. I enjoy turning an idea or requirement into a practical product, deploying it, and continuously improving it.

I'm particularly interested in the intersection of backend engineering and AI: LLM applications, AI agents, persistent memory, RAG systems, vector search, data infrastructure, and making these systems practical and reliable.

Engineering Philosophy

I care about understanding the core problem, building practical backend architectures, and learning from how systems operate in the real world.

01.

Understand the Problem First

I prefer understanding the actual problem and user needs before jumping into implementation. The goal is to solve the right problem, not write excess code.

02.

Break Complex Problems Down

When a problem looks complicated, I break it into smaller modular components, understand responsibilities, and solve them incrementally.

03.

Prefer Practical Architecture

I care about scalability and good architecture, but I also value simplicity. Architecture should solve actual constraints without introducing artificial complexity.

04.

Build and Iterate

I learn heavily through implementation. I prefer building a working system, observing where it fails, measuring performance, and improving it iteratively.

05.

Understand the Whole System

My interest goes beyond application code. I enjoy understanding databases, networking, Linux, containers, deployment pipelines, and software operation.

06.

Build for Real Use

I enjoy software that solves real problems for real users. Requirements, cost, deployment, maintainability, and reliability are all core engineering responsibilities.
